    I had to make a customized route recently. Because the NAV system had me going over 150 more miles than I needed to go to get to my destination. I had to put a "waypoint" at an intersection on my route and include that in the destination. How come I couldn't save that route?

    How come there is no way to review past routes? No way to re-play the last month worth of routes that that vehicle has taken.

    Seems like if this NAV system is so expensive, it should do what my Garmin hand held does.

    I would like to be able to fold/unfold the outside mirrors from the inside. My daughter's Passat lets her do that. Today I was out, looked at the passenger side window and it was folded in since someone had to get past the car in our garage and didn't put it back (he will be reminded when he gets home). Anyway, it is a nice feature to be able to control that from inside the car.
